The Situation

Look at the table and it tells you everything straight away. Örgryte are sitting 15th in the Allsvenskan with 13 points from 17 games. Three wins, four draws, ten defeats. A goal difference of minus nineteen. They have conceded forty league goals this season. Forty. That is not a defence, mate, that is a suggestion.

Meanwhile Hammarby are up in second place. Thirty-three points from 17 games. Ten wins, three draws, four defeats. They have scored forty goals themselves and only let in fifteen. This is a side absolutely purring right now, and they are only nine points behind the leaders with games still to play.

Örgryte's Home Record... Actually Hear Me Out

Look, Örgryte are bad. I am not going to sit here and pretend otherwise. But their home form has one thing going for it. Goals. Loads of them. In their last five home games, they have seen eighty percent of matches go over 2.5 goals. Eighty percent! And the BTTS rate at home is even more eye-watering. In their last ten home matches, both teams have scored in 87.5 percent of games.

Their home record over those ten games reads one win, four draws, three losses. Goals for: fourteen. Goals against: sixteen. So they are leaking plenty, but they are at least putting the ball in the net themselves. They are not completely toothless at home. Far from it.

Hammarby: The Numbers Are Tasty

Honestly, Hammarby's stats this season are something else. Forty goals scored, fifteen conceded in 17 league games. That is a goal difference of plus twenty-five. Better than the team sitting top of the table in terms of goal difference, which is genuinely mad when you think about it.

I actually looked at the numbers for once and... the underlying data backs it up too. Their xG figures for the season show 27.3 expected goals scored against 14.0 expected goals conceded.
